Developing Powerful Athletes… ⬇️ 1. Lift Heavy. 3-6 Rep Sets. Basics work best: Squat, Bench, Deadlift. 2. Sprint Max Effort 2-3x Week. 3. Jump Max Effort 2-3x Week. 4. Long Rest Breaks. 5. Track Training, Chase PRs. These five things are necessary for maximizing Training!

In-season Strength Training Guide for Improved Performance without Soreness Feel free to Bookmark this👇🏻 1. Low Training Volumes 1-2 working sets per exercise. 2. Limit sessions to 3-5 exercises. 3. Limit length of session to 60 minutes maximum 4. Loads over 80%, reps between 1-5. 5. Ample rest 6. Training should be done 2-4x a week. As frequency goes up, workload pulls back per session. 7. Movement selection stays the same as off-season, novelty creates soreness. Push, Pull, Squat, Hinge. 8. Continue progressing training, you will still improve slowly. The key is not going backwards. 9. Continue Sprinting and Jumping Maximally in-season. 10. Use training to address ranges that may be banged up from games. Takeaway: NEVER STOP TRAINING.
